示例#1
0
 /// <summary>
 /// 可设置repository的构造函数(主要用于测试用例)
 /// </summary>
 public ApplicationService(IRepository <ApplicationModel> applicationRepository,
                           IRepository <ApplicationInPresentAreaSetting> applicationSettingRepository,
                           IApplicationInPresentAreaInstallationRepository applicationInstallationRepository,
                           Func <int, ApplicationConfig> getConfig)
 {
     this.applicationRepository             = applicationRepository;
     this.applicationSettingRepository      = applicationSettingRepository;
     this.applicationInstallationRepository = applicationInstallationRepository;
     this.getConfig = getConfig;
 }
示例#2
0
 /// <summary>
 /// 可设置repository的构造函数(主要用于测试用例)
 /// </summary>
 public ApplicationService(IRepository<ApplicationModel> applicationRepository,
     IRepository<ApplicationInPresentAreaSetting> applicationSettingRepository,
     IApplicationInPresentAreaInstallationRepository applicationInstallationRepository,
     Func<int, ApplicationConfig> getConfig)
 {
     this.applicationRepository = applicationRepository;
     this.applicationSettingRepository = applicationSettingRepository;
     this.applicationInstallationRepository = applicationInstallationRepository;
     this.getConfig = getConfig;
 }